I seem to have screwed up big time, I have a 80 GB Harddrive in two partitions C: 30GB and D: 50GB. I had a backupGhost image of Win XP on the D: drive. I decided to copy it across and install a few new drivers, when I tried to do this the copy across to C: failed and I was left with a hanging system on bootup. The only option I had was to use an old Ghost image of Win Me on Cd Rom and copy that to the C: drive, I can now get Windows Me to load but it doesn't seen to have seen the D: 50GB partition. The C: in Win Me still says it's 30 GB so I'm guessing that the D: is intact but I cant think of how to access it, I have a load of files and programs in there that I need.

Has anyone got any clue to how I can get windows to see this partition ???
Any help would be great.
 
Yup until you re-install WinXP (2K or NT) you won't be able to read your NTFS partition D:

Unless of course you purchase NTFSDOS from Sysinternals or something like that.
